6. Weight capacity
Weight capacity is a crucial specification for any shelving unit, including three-tier bookshelves offered by major retailers. This characteristic dictates the maximum load that each shelf can safely support without compromising structural integrity, directly influencing the types of items that can be stored and the overall lifespan of the unit. Ignoring specified weight limits can lead to shelf sagging, structural damage, or even complete collapse.
-
Shelf Material and Construction
The materials used in the shelf construction, such as particleboard, MDF, or solid wood, significantly impact weight capacity. Particleboard, commonly used in affordable shelving, typically has a lower weight capacity compared to solid wood. The thickness and support structure beneath the shelf also play a critical role. A thicker shelf with reinforced supports can withstand greater weight. Real-world examples include observing the bowing of particleboard shelves under a load of heavy books, contrasting with the stability of solid wood shelves under similar conditions. This directly relates to the suitability of the shelf for storing different types of items.
-
Weight Distribution
The manner in which weight is distributed across the shelf influences its load-bearing capability. Concentrated weight in a single area places greater stress on that specific point, increasing the risk of sagging or breakage. Evenly distributing the weight across the shelf surface is essential to maximize the unit’s overall capacity. Examples include placing heavy objects like encyclopedias in the center of the shelf and lighter items towards the edges. This principle underscores the importance of understanding load distribution to prevent structural failure.
-
Overall Unit Stability
The overall stability of the shelving unit contributes to its effective weight capacity. A unit with a wide base and sturdy construction is less prone to tipping or wobbling under load, enhancing its ability to safely support the specified weight. Conversely, a flimsy or poorly constructed unit may be unstable, even if the individual shelves are rated for a certain weight. This highlights the need to consider the entire unit’s design and construction, not just the shelf materials.

Tips for Selecting and Using a Three-Tier Bookshelf (Walmart)
The following provides guidance for selecting and effectively utilizing a three-tier bookshelf purchased from a major retailer. Adherence to these recommendations can optimize product lifespan and user satisfaction.
Tip 1: Assess Space and Measurement Prior to Purchase: Accurately measure the intended location for the shelving unit. Ensure adequate clearance for placement and accessibility. Confirm that the dimensions of the bookshelf align with the available space.
Tip 2: Review Product Specifications and Customer Reviews: Carefully examine product specifications, including weight capacity, materials, and dimensions. Consult customer reviews for insights into assembly difficulty, durability, and overall satisfaction. Prioritize units with positive feedback regarding structural integrity.
Tip 3: Adhere to Weight Capacity Guidelines: Distribute weight evenly across each shelf. Avoid exceeding the specified weight limit to prevent sagging or structural damage. Place heavier items on the lower shelves for increased stability.
Tip 4: Utilize Proper Assembly Techniques: Follow the assembly instructions meticulously. Ensure all components are securely fastened. If encountering difficulties, consult online resources or seek assistance from experienced individuals.
Tip 5: Implement Anchoring for Stability: For enhanced stability, particularly in households with children or pets, consider anchoring the bookshelf to a wall. Utilize appropriate anchoring hardware and follow manufacturer guidelines.
Tip 6: Periodic Inspection and Maintenance: Conduct regular inspections of the shelving unit. Tighten any loose screws or fasteners. Address any signs of damage or wear promptly. Implement cleaning practices appropriate for the shelf material.
Tip 7: Optimize Shelf Organization: Strategically organize items on the shelves to maximize space utilization and aesthetic appeal. Group similar items together and consider using storage containers or baskets to maintain order.
